Construction d'une matrice
Attention : numpy librairie de calcul numérique pour python
Il faut importer, la librairie numpy en utilisant la commande :
import numpy as np
Méthode :
Pour construire la matrice suivante :
\(A=\begin{pmatrix} 1&0&3&5 \\4&8&6&0\\7&8&9&10\\2&3&1&3 \end{pmatrix}=(a_{ij})\)
\(B=\begin{pmatrix}5\\6\\7\end{pmatrix}\)
Sous python,il faut taper
A = np.array([[1, 0, 3, 5],[4, 8, 6, 0],[7, 8, 9, 10],[2, 3, 1, 3]],np.float32)
B = np.array([[5], [6], [7]],np.float32)
A
B
Le champ shape des variables A et B permet d'obtenir la taille d'une matrice:
A.shape
B.shape
Les variables A et B sont en réalité des objets.
Il faut remarquer que B est une matrice de 3 lignes et 1 colonne.
Les variables A et B sont donc définies comme ceci. Le champ shape permet d'avoir la taille d'une matrice, c'est à dire son nombre de lignes et de colonnes.